Why You Should Attend

During the economic downturn, employers in all sectors are focusing on how to maximise the contribution of employees. This event addresses how to nurture employee wellbeing and engagement for competitive advantage in line with responsible business practice. BITC’s second Health and Work Summit will bring together employers from all sectors to share best practice on how to make the wellbeing and engagement of people a strategic issue. The case for taking action has never been more compelling.

Leading employers will explain how making employee wellbeing a boardroom issue has resulted in significant business benefits. BITC’s new FTSE 100 research conducted by MORI will highlight key performance indicators that leading companies are currently using to demonstrate value to shareholders. A key theme of the Summit will also highlight the crucial role of line managers. Interactive workshops, practical tools and award winning case studies will show how you can harness employee wellbeing with benefits for employee retention and recruitment, talent management, better attendance, corporate reputation and productivity.
